Merge tag 'for-v4.0-rc/meson-dts' of https://github.com/carlocaione/linux-meson into next/dt

Pull "meson DTS changes" from Carlo Caione:

- New DTS for MINIX NEO-X8
- Add DTS support for SPIFC, Ethernet controller and pinctrl

* tag 'for-v4.0-rc/meson-dts' of https://github.com/carlocaione/linux-meson:
  ARM: dts: meson: add DTS file for MINIX NEO-X8
  ARM: dts: meson8: add pinctrl node
  ARM: dts: meson: enable Ethernet controller
  ARM: dts: meson: add node for SPIFC

/dts-v1/;
#include <dt-bindings/gpio/gpio.h>
#include "meson8.dtsi"
/ {
model = "MINIX NEO-X8";
compatible = "minix,neo-x8", "amlogic,meson8";
aliases {
serial0 = &uart_AO;
};
memory {
reg = <0x40000000 0x80000000>;
};
gpio-leds {
compatible = "gpio-leds";
blue {
label = "x8:blue:power";
gpios = <&gpio_ao GPIO_TEST_N GPIO_ACTIVE_HIGH>;
};
};
};
&uart_AO {
status = "okay";
pinctrl-0 = <&uart_ao_a_pins>;
pinctrl-names = "default";
};
&i2c_AO {
status = "okay";
pinctrl-0 = <&i2c_ao_pins>;
pinctrl-names = "default";
pmic@32 {
compatible = "ricoh,rn5t618";
reg = <0x32>;
regulators {
};
};
rtc@51 {
compatible = "nxp,pcf8563";
reg = <0x51>;
};
};
&spifc {
status = "okay";
pinctrl-0 = <&spi_nor_pins>;
pinctrl-names = "default";
spi-flash@0 {
compatible = "mxicy,mx25l1606e";
#address-cells = <1>;
#size-cells = <1>;
reg = <0>;
spi-max-frequency = <30000000>;
partition@0 {
label = "boot";
reg = <0x0 0x100000>;
};
partition@100000 {
label = "env";
reg = <0x100000 0x10000>;
};
};
};
&ir_receiver {
status = "okay";
pinctrl-0 = <&ir_recv_pins>;
pinctrl-names = "default";
};
&ethmac {
status = "okay";
pinctrl-0 = <&eth_pins>;
pnictrl-names = "default";
};
